Influence of multi-walled carbon nanotubes reinforced honeycomb core on vibration and damping responses of carbon fiber composite sandwich shell structures

Apichit Maneengam et al.

Summary: In this study, the vibration and damping characteristics of multi-walled carbon nanotubes (MWCNT) reinforced honeycomb embedded sandwich composite shell structures were investigated numerically using finite element (FE) method. The efficacy of the FE method was verified by comparing the natural frequencies assessed using ABAQUS 3D FE model. The study explored the influence of MWCNT reinforcement, support condition, and radius of curvature on the dynamic performance of honeycomb sandwich shell with carbon fiber reinforced polymer (CFRP) composite face sheets. Additionally, the optimal ply orientations of various configurations of CFRP sandwich shells with MWCNT/GFRP honeycomb were identified using the developed FE model coupled with genetic algorithm (GA) to enhance the natural frequencies and loss factors.

Tensile and flexural behavior of metal/CFRP hybrid laminated plates

Chenyu Zhou et al.

Summary: The study on metal/CFRP hybrid laminated plates showed that with increasing number of CFRP layers, the tensile strength increased while the tensile modulus decreased, and the bending strength increased while the bending modulus decreased. The numerical parametric study revealed that the tensile modulus and strength decreased with increasing number of 45 degrees CFRP layers.

The effect of superimposed ultrasonic vibration on tensile behavior of 6061-T6 aluminum alloy

Bangfu Wu et al.

Summary: Ultrasonic vibration can reduce the forming force of metallic materials, improve their deformation ability and surface quality, without permanently altering their mechanical properties. It reduces the stress required for deformation without changing the Young's modulus and strain hardening rate.
